With one day in LA you will prolly have to pick an area and do activities/lunch/dinner there, I got a few spots from my last visit
Malibu: point dune (beautiful views of Malibu, easy trail), Malibu farm restaurant/geoffery (lunch with amazing views), Malibu county mart (shopping/walk around). Malibu is complete beach/surfer vibes. The drive on pacific coast highway is beautiful
West Hollywood/Beverly Hills: matcha or coffee at La La land or community goods. I get the banana matcha from La La land, rodeo drive (designer strip/solid food places), melrose (cool stores) the comedy store (best stand up acts come here, recommend getting tickets early - evening activity), can hotel hop along the strip at night, most hotels have a club area (One Hotel, the edition, some others I’m forgetting)
Santa Monica: Montana avenue (can get a coffee, check out some cool shops, get good lunch), bergamont arts station (cool industrial buildings with a bunch of art exhibitions). If you check out the pier it’s pretty crowded so heads up there
Venice beach: Abbott Kinney (great shops, good food spots around)
